Exploring Different Styles of Nasheed
Nasheed, lyrical form stemming from Islamic culture, isn't a single type. Examining the diverse range of Nasheed styles highlights a rich tapestry of musical techniques. From the older style, often featuring simple instrumentation and focused lyrical content revolving around praise for Allah and the Prophet Muhammad (peace be upon him), to more modern iterations incorporating influences of urban and pop music, there’s a sound for many. Some Nasheed artists embrace Qasidah, a poetic structure , while others push boundaries with digital beats and layered vocal harmonies . To conclude, exploring these distinct styles offers a unique insight into the evolving world of Islamic devotional music.
